Pitsford Water week ending 29 August

2 years ago

Fish week 142 (Season 8,386) Returns 38 (1,410) Rod average 3.7 (5.9)

Pitsford sport has been unpredictable with good days followed by more challenging days. Methods are varied and it seems that if you drop on fish they will happily take flies fished in the surface but they are very localised. 

Drifting to cover more water is definitely the best method and floating or tip lines are best. Some fish are coming to the dries with red or claret best. 

Foam daddies and floating fry patterns are working as well as washing line with diawls and crunchers. The fish are still mostly holding in the main basin. 

Bank anglers are starting to find fish in the margins with the Cliffs and Sailing Club bank being productive. Fry and shrimp patterns are taking these fish. 

There is a further stocking of 2,000 fish planned for this week which should freshen things up.
